Conservatory Tower
Conservatory Tower is an apartment building in Old Toronto, Toronto, Ontario. Conservatory Tower is situated nearby to the park Lord and Lady Martonmere Gardens, as well as near the post office Bay and Gerrard Canada Post.Places of Interest Nearby

Yonge-Dundas

Yonge-Dundas is the very heart of downtown Toronto—in more ways than one. After all, the major arterials of Yonge Street and Dundas Street meet here. The resulting intersection is probably the city's busiest, at least for pedestrians.
Toronto General Hospital

The Toronto General Hospital is a major teaching hospital in Toronto, Ontario, Canada, and the flagship campus of University Health Network. It is located in the Discovery District of Downtown Toronto along University Avenue's Hospital Row; it is directly north of The Hospital for Sick Children, across Gerrard Street West, and east of Princess Margaret Cancer Centre and Mount Sinai Hospital. Downtown Toronto

Downtown Toronto is the main city centre of Toronto, Ontario, Canada. Located entirely within the district of Old Toronto, it is approximately 16.6 square kilometres in area, bordered by Bloor Street to the northeast, a Canadian Pacific Railway line to the northwest, Lake Ontario to the south, the Don Valley to the east, and Bathurst Street to the west.
Downtown Yonge

Downtown Yonge is a retail and entertainment district centred on Yonge Street in Downtown Toronto, Ontario, Canada. The Downtown Yonge district is bounded by Richmond Street to the south; Grosvenor and Alexander Streets to the north; Bay Street to the west; and portions of Church Street, Victoria Street, and Bond Street to the east.
